Project Management Professional® (PMP) Certification Training

Course Outline

The Project Management Professional (PMP) certification demonstrates that you have the knowledge, experience, and skills to successfully manage and complete projects.

This PMP® Certification Training course will help you prepare for and successfully pass the PMP Certification exam while helping you sharpen your skills and knowledge to increase your competitive edge in the project management profession.

  • PMP Certification Training Recommended Experience

    This course will be most valuable for experienced project managers planning to take the PMP certification exam.

    You should have at least three years of experience as a project manager to benefit from this course.

  • Certification Information

    This course satisfies the requirement of 35 PDUs to take the PMP exam.

Instructor-Led PMP Certification Training Outline

Lesson 1: Business Environment

In this lesson, you will learn about:

  • The Foundational project management concepts
  • The Agile mindset and the hybrid approach
  • Strategic alignment
  • Project benefits and value
  • Organizational culture and change management
  • Project governance
  • Project Compliance

Lesson 2: Start the Project

In this lesson, you will learn how to start a project:

  • Identify and Engage Stakeholders
  • Team Formation
  • Build Shared Understanding
  • Decide Project Approach/Methodology

Lesson 3: Plan the Project

In this lesson, you will learn how plan for a project:

  • Planning Projects
  • Scope
  • Schedule
  • Resources
  • Budget
  • Risks
  • Quality
  • Integrate Plans

Lesson 4: Lead the Project Team  

In this lesson, you will learn how to lead a project team:

  • Craft Your Leadership Style
  • Create a Collaborative Project Team Environment
  • Empower the Team
  • Support Team Member Performance
  • Communicate and Collaborate with Stakeholders
  • Train Team Members and Stakeholders
  • Manage Conflict

Lesson 5: Support Project Team Performance

In this lesson, you will learn how to support team performance:

  • Implement Ongoing Improvements
  • Support Performance
  • Evaluate Project Progress
  • Manage Issues and Impediments
  • Manage Changes

Lesson 6: Close the Project/Phase

In this lesson, you will learn how to close a project or a phase:

  • Project/Phase Closure
  • Benefits Realization
  • Knowledge Transfer
